Frank Scott Parkway, Belleville, USA Illinois, North America

Frank Scott Parkway is a multi-lane parkway located in Belleville, Illinois, USA. It serves as a significant transportation corridor within the region.

Visual Characteristics

The parkway consists of paved asphalt surfaces with multiple lanes in each direction, separated by a grass median. Concrete barriers and guardrails line the edges. Street lighting is installed at regular intervals. The surrounding landscape is primarily composed of managed grass, trees, and drainage ditches.

Location & Access Logistics

Frank Scott Parkway is situated approximately 3.2 kilometers (2 miles) south of Downtown Belleville, Illinois. Access is provided via multiple interchanges with Illinois Route 159 and Illinois Route 15. Ample on-site parking is not available as it is a public roadway. Public transportation options directly serving the parkway are limited; however, bus routes operate on adjacent arterial roads like Illinois Route 159.
